The binomial distribution models the probability of a sequence of binary outcomes, where there are n independent trials and the probability of success on each trial is p. The distribution is parameterized by two values: n, the number of trials, and p, the probability of success on each trial. The binomial distribution gives the probability of getting exactly k successes in n trials.

In the code example, we create a binom object from the scipy.stats module with the given values of n and p, and then use its pmf method to calculate the probability of getting exactly 3 successes. We also use its rvs method to generate a sample of 10 outcomes from the distribution, and plot the PMF of the distribution using matplotlib.
